Osias Hofstätter
Osias Hofstätter (1905-1994), born in Galicia (now Poland), was a prominent painter who created throughout most of his adult life, which involved charged experiences of refuge, exile, and loss. His works primarily depicted figures, animals, and hybrid creatures with an expressive approach and a distinctive signature.
